Clapton And King Together Again
10/05/1999 4:00 AM, Yahoo! Music Craig Rosen
(10/5/99, 1 a.m. PDT) - Eric Clapton and B.B. King will once again join substantial guitar forces, this time for a new album. A spokesperson for Reprise Records, Clapton's label, confirms that the guitarist has studio plans with King in January. The nature of the project is unknown, as is the home of the resulting album, although the spokesperson hoped it would be Reprise, which will release Clapton Chronicles: The Best Of Eric Clapton, on Oct. 12. King records for MCA Records. Both Clapton and King are on the bill for VH1's Save The Music benefit "Concert Of The Century." Also on the Oct. 23 bill at the White House in Washington, D.C. will be Aretha Franklin, John Fogerty, John Mellencamp, Bono, Gloria Estefan, Sheryl Crow, Lenny Kravitz, 'N Sync, and Late Show With David Letterman bandleader Paul Shaffer, who is the event's music director.
